Carl Von Glinow Obituary

Carl Von Glinow
Carl A. Von Glinow, 82, of Sunset Hills, Mo., born May 5, 1925, in St. Louis, Mo., died Monday, Dec. 24, 2007, at Friendship Village Health Center.
Carl was a retired Vice President of Ostertag Optical Service where he worked 42 years. He was a member of St. Lucas United Church of Christ. He was a World War II veteran of the U.S. Navy where he
served in the Pacific Theater on the U.S.S. St. Louis. The past few years he worked with students of the Special School District teaching them woodworking and carpentry skills. For his dedication and service to his students, Carl was a recipient of the Special Ambassador Award.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Alfred and Rosa, nee Wertner, Von Glinow.
Surviving are his wife of 59 years, Ruth, nee Hammers, Von Glinow; a son, Gary C. (Catherine) Von Glinow of Lake Forest, Ill.; a daughter, Karen A. (Joseph) Milton of Swansea, Ill.; five grandchildren, J. Matthew (fiance, Lauren Scharf) Milton of Millstadt, Ill., Monica A. (Matthew) Ticknor of Belleville, Ill., Mark C. Milton of Swansea, Ill., Alison M. Von Glinow, and Kiki E. Von Glinow both of Lake Forest, Ill. He will be sadly missed by sister-in-law, brother-in-law, nieces and nephews.
Memorials may be made to St. Lucas United Church of Christ.

Visitation: Friends may call from 10 to 11 a.m. Friday, Dec. 28, 2007, at St. Lucas United Church of Christ, Sappington, Mo.

Funeral: A Memorial Service will be at 11 a.m. Friday, Dec. 28, 2007, at St. Lucas United Church of Christ, Sappinton, Mo. Cremation and private burial will take place at a later time.
